Bahrain International Airshow Set Sights High for Industry-wide Growth

As a strategic hub for the aviation industry, Bahrain has consistently played a pivotal role in fostering regional growth and innovation. Following a successful year for the Bahrain military and civil aerospace sectors, Bahrain International Airshow (BIAS) has set its sights high for industry-wide growth and development ahead of its 2024 edition.
 
Held under the patronage of His Majesty King Hamad bin Isa Al Khalifa, King of the Kingdom of Bahrain, and under the supervision of His Highness Sheikh Abdullah bin Hamad Al Khalifa, Personal Representative of His Majesty the King, and the Chairman of BIAS’ Supreme Organising Committee, the airshow will take place from 13 to 15 November 2024 at Sakhir Airbase Bahrain.
 
Since the 2022 airshow, Bahrain has continued to grow, with multiple new partnerships signed, millions in investments announced and achieving a GDP growth of 4.9 per cent, the highest rate since 2013.
 
 Earlier this year, the Royal Bahrain Air Force (RBAF), as part of the Bahrain Defence Force (BDF), expanded its fleet of aircraft with the delivery of the first F-16 Block 70 fighter jet from Lockheed Martin. This made Bahrain the first country in the world to receive highly equipped and advanced combat aircraft. The RBAF also acquired three Bell 505 helicopters from Bell Textron to join the air force’s existing group of Bell 212 and multiple generations of AH-1 attack helicopters.
 
 As a growing commercial and tourism hub, air passenger traffic in Bahrain continues to grow, with Bahrain International Airport (BIA) welcoming 6.9 million passengers in 2022, a 127.5 per cent jump from 2021. As part of its plan to propel the region forward even further, Gulf Air, the national air carrier of Bahrain, has introduced new offerings and services, including the launch of Gulf Air Holidays, in partnership with Bahrain Tourism and Exhibition Authority (BTEA) and a codeshare partnership with Emirates that provides easy connections and expanded choices for Gulf Air customers, enabling them to connect to Dubai and onwards to a host of Emirates destinations across Europe, Africa, South America, and the Far East.
 
 As well as servicing the business and tourism travel markets, Bahrain has established itself as a leading cargo centre within the region. A new 25,000 sqm ‘Cargo Express Village’ has been developed at BIA to facilitate the efficient handling of cargo, featuring a bonded logistical facility and an admin building concept, which is being developed in three phases.
 
Flying High
Organised by the Bahrain Ministry of Transportation and Telecommunications and the RBAF in association with Farnborough International, BIAS has been designed to reflect aerospace and defence industry demands, in addition to Bahrain’s exponential development in aerospace. It will also harness global expertise to provide crucial thought leadership and insight.
 
The exhibition halls feature the latest aerospace products and services and offer networking opportunities through various trade programmes, conferences, seminars and workshops.

Furthermore, Bahrain has one of the best aircraft displays across the airshow circuit, with stunning static and daily flying displays featuring the latest in both military jets and commercial aircraft.
Following the resounding success of the 2022 airshow, which saw over 30 countries present, 186 participating companies across the display, exhibition hall and chalets, and 200 civilian and military delegations taking part, the 2024 edition will engage, retain, and grow its delegation programme, providing visitors with an opportunity to network with high-level decision-makers. 
 
The show continues to attract the industry’s leading players, including Airbus, CFM, Leonardo, Lockheed Martin, and Rolls-Royce. Recently, Lockheed Martin announced its participation and sponsorship of BIAS 2024. The partnership signifies the global aerospace and defence manufacturer’s longstanding ties with the airshow and the wider Gulf region.
 
For more than 10 years, BIAS has been a platform for business generation for global aerospace leaders in the gateway to the Gulf. The event connects the world’s aerospace industry in a distinguished environment, offering access to high-level delegations and opening new opportunities to businesses of all sizes.

The 2024 airshow will see further development, a new look and feel with BIAS after undertaking a programme of significant investment, enhanced show features, and more opportunities for business, networking, growth, and knowledge sharing. Now in its seventh year, BIAS has cemented itself as a must-attend biennial event in the aerospace and defence industry. It is renowned for bringing the best of the aerospace industry together to do business .
